Mobility Ramp Construction in Conroe, TX
Mobility ramp construction services provide accessible solutions for homeowners seeking to improve entryways and outdoor pathways. These projects typically involve building or installing ramps that accommodate wheelchairs, walkers, or other mobility aids, ensuring safe and convenient access to homes, porches, and garages. Property owners often request these services when making modifications for aging-in-place, accommodating family members with mobility challenges, or complying with accessibility needs for visitors. It’s important to consider factors such as the location, slope, and materials used to ensure the ramp is safe, durable, and suitable for the property’s specific environment.
Before requesting mobility ramp constru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the size and design options, as well as any local building codes or regulations that may apply. Clarifying the intended use, preferred materials, and budget can help determine the best solution. Additionally, understanding the existing terrain and entryway conditions can influence the planning process, ensuring the final structure provides reliable access and fits seamlessly into the property’s layout.

Mobility Ramp Construction Questions
What types of mobility ramps are available for construction? Various options include portable, modular, and custom-built ramps to suit different property needs and accessibility requirements.
What should property owners consider before building a mobility ramp? It's important to evaluate the location, slope, and surface to ensure safety and ease of use for all users.
Are mobility ramps suitable for all types of properties? Yes, they can be installed on residential, commercial, and multi-unit properties to improve accessibility.
What materials are commonly used in mobility ramp construction?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and composite, chosen for durability and low maintenance.
